Travelpro Maxlite 5 Softside Expandable Luggage 4 Spinner
- ✓ Ultra-lightweight design
- ✓ Smooth 360° spinner wheels
- ✓ Durable, eco-friendly materials
- ✕ Slightly pricey
- ✕ Limited color options
| Dimensions | 19″ x 15″ x 7.75″ (case), 21.75″ x 15.75″ x 7.75″ (overall with wheels and handles) |
| Weight | 5.3 lbs (2.4 kg) |
| Volume | 39 liters |
| Material | Stain-resistant polyester with water-resistant DuraGuard coating |
| Wheel Type | 360° spinner wheels |
| Handle | PowerScope Lite telescoping handle with stops at 38″ and 42.5″ |
Opening the Travelpro Maxlite 5, I immediately noticed how lightweight it is—almost startling for its size. Weighing in at just 5.3 pounds, it felt effortless to lift onto the baggage scale and carry up stairs without breaking a sweat.
The softside exterior, made from stain-resistant polyester with a water-resistant DuraGuard coating, felt sturdy yet pliable. I appreciated the textured surface, which seemed to hide fingerprints and scuffs after a few trips.
The zippers were high-strength and smooth, gliding easily even when packed tight.
Rolling it around was a breeze thanks to the 360° spinner wheels—quiet, smooth, and responsive in every direction. The PowerScope Lite handle adjusted effortlessly at both 38″ and 42.5″, and the contour grip felt comfortable against my palm during longer pulls.
The bottom tray added stability, preventing wobbling on uneven surfaces.
When I expanded the case, the extra 2 inches of space was noticeable but didn’t compromise stability. The organized interior with multiple pockets and straps made packing easier—no more digging through a jumbled mess.
The exterior pockets held quick-access items like travel documents and a water bottle.
Overall, the Maxlite 5 feels like a reliable travel companion—light, durable, and versatile. It checks all the boxes for a 19-inch carry-on that can handle both short trips and longer journeys with ease.
Plus, the limited lifetime warranty offers peace of mind for rougher travels.
TOTAL TRAVELWARE Passage 19-Inch Expandable Hardside Spinner
- ✓ Lightweight and durable
- ✓ Smooth 360 spinner wheels
- ✓ Fully organized interior
- ✕ Slightly bulky when expanded
- ✕ Check airline size limits
| Material | Durable hardside composite construction |
| Dimensions | 19 H x 13.5 W x 9 D inches (packing), 21.5 H x 13.5 W x 9 D inches (including wheels) |
| Weight | 6.3 lbs |
| Expansion Capacity | 2 expansion zippers for increased packing space |
| Wheel System | 360 dual spinner wheels with reinforced housings |
| Handle | Locking push button telescoping handle with contoured grip |
The first thing that caught my eye when I grabbed the Total Travelware Passage 19 Spinner was how lightweight it felt in my hand. Despite its sturdy-looking hardside shell, it was surprisingly easy to lift into the overhead bin.
As I packed, I appreciated how smoothly the zippers glided open, revealing a fully lined interior with a mesh divider and tie-down straps that kept my clothes neatly in place.
Loading it up was a breeze thanks to the expandable feature. I easily squeezed in a few extra outfits without feeling like I was forcing the bag shut.
The 360 dual spinner wheels rolled effortlessly across different surfaces, making maneuvering through busy airports a stress-free experience. The contoured push-button handle felt both solid and comfortable, giving me confidence that it could handle multiple trips.
What really impressed me was how secure everything felt inside. The reinforced wheel housings and upgraded carry handle added a layer of durability I didn’t expect from such a lightweight bag.
It fit perfectly in overhead compartments on most planes, saving me time at baggage claim. Plus, the 5-year warranty gave me peace of mind, knowing it’s built to last.
Overall, this carry-on combines smart design, lightweight construction, and thoughtful features. It’s ideal for quick trips, business travel, or weekend getaways.
The only slight downside is that the expansion feature adds bulk, so you’ll want to double-check your airline’s size restrictions once expanded.

Briggs & Riley:
Briggs & Riley luggage is recognized for its lifetime warranty and unique expansion features. Its unique CX technology allows luggage to expand and then compress back to its original size, providing extra packing space when needed. Customers appreciate the brand’s commitment to quality and repair services. -
